Selected Pairs table

The following table shows the items in this table.

NOTE:

The Selected Pairs table appears on the Confirm window and the Split Pairs window of

the Split Pairs wizard. The table for the items on the Confirm window is shown with that window.

Description

Item

The P-VOL information.

Primary Volume

Values:

LDEV ID: The P-VOL’s LDEV identifier.

LDEV Name: The P-VOL’s LDEV name.

Emulation Type: The P-VOL’s emulation type.

Capacity: The P-VOL’s volume capacity

CLPR: The P-VOL’s CLPR number.

The types of pairs.

Copy Type

Values:

BC-L1: BC/SS L1

BC-L2: BC/SS L2

BC Z: BC Z

FS: FS

The status for the pair.

Status

For more information about pair status, see

“The RWC pair status names and

descriptions” (page 63)

.

The S-VOL information.

Secondary Volume

Values:

LDEV ID: The S-VOL’s LDEV identifier

LDEV Name: The S-VOL’s LDEV name

Emulation Type: The S-VOL’s emulation type

Capacity: The S-VOL’s volume capacity

CLPR: The S-VOL’s CLPR number

The mirror unit number.

Mirror Unit

The split type.

Split Type list

Values:

Quick Split: The pair is split and then the data is copied so that the S-VOL is
immediately available for read and write I/O. Any remaining differential
data is copied to the S-VOL in the background.

For FS, this value is not shown.

Steady Split: Splits the pair after all of the differential data is copied.

BC and BC Z only.

Copy Pace list

The system option that determines the rate at which you want the XP7 storage
system to copy data.

Values:

Slower: Improved host server I/O performance but slower processing speed.

Medium: Average processing speed and host server I/O performance.

Faster: Faster processing speed but slower host server I/O performance.
